Requirements

  • Essential
  • Computer literate including proficient use of Microsoft Office
  • Fluent in both English and Italian
  • Excellent administration / organisational skills
  • Ability to prioritise effectively and manage multiple tasks
  • Excellent attention to detail to be able to carefully analyse information
  • Ability to work well under pressure and to tight deadlines
  • Excellent teamwork skills
  • Desirable
  • A good team spirit with excellent communications skills

Responsibilities

  • Opening claims and entering payments in the system
  • Reviewing and managing incoming emails and voicemails, ensuring compliance with service level agreements
  • Supporting Claims Handlers with tasks to manage their workloads efficiently
  • Performing all general administrative tasks

Mission & Purpose

DWF is a leading global provider of integrated legal and business services. We listen to our clients and there is a growing desire for legal and business services to be delivered in an easier and more efficient way. So, we've built our business and designed our range of services on this principle. We have three offerings – Legal Services, Legal Operations and Business Services. Our ability to seamlessly combine any number of these services to deliver bespoke solutions for our clients is our key differentiator. Delivered through our global teams across eight core sectors, our Integrated Legal Management approach delivers greater efficiency, price certainty and transparency for our clients without compromising on quality or service.
